✦ Synopsis
A formula involving a difference of the products of four q-binomial coefficiems is shown to count pairs of nonintersecting lattice paths having a prescribed number of weighted turns. The weights are assigned to account for the location of the turns according to the major and lesser indices. The result, which is a q-analogue of a variant of the formula of Kreweras and Poupard, is proved bijectively; however, when q ~ 1 the bijection is defined inductively.
